A Grown-Up Grilled Cheese Sandwich
(firmenpresse) - MISSION, KS -- (Marketwire) -- 04/09/12 -- (Family Features) A classic grilled cheese sandwich is one of the iconic foods of childhood. And while plenty of people still enjoy a basic grilled cheese, many are looking for ways to take their favorite sandwich from the kiddie table to the grownup table.
Of course, your choice of cheese is the key to the perfect sandwich. Different types of cheese will provide unique flavors and textures. Experimenting with new ingredients can also dress up everybody's favorite sandwich. In honor of National Grilled Cheese Month this April, create your own signature sandwich with additions such as:
Fresh or sun dried tomatoes
Bacon or prosciutto
Avocado
Fresh herbs such as sage, basil, oregano or cilantro
Jalapeño
Pickles
Roasted red peppers
Caramelized onions
Flavored cheese slices such as Southwest Pepperjack, Smoked Cheddar or Applewood Bacon Cheddar
Apple or pear slices
Dijon or honey mustard
Smoked or mesquite turkey
You can also change things up with different breads. Try pumpernickel, rye, seven-grain, sourdough or English muffin bread.
